Frequently Asked Questions

Q: How much does a high-capacity USB-C power bank weigh?

A: Most 20,000 mAh USB-C PD power banks weigh between 800 g and 1 kg, making them easy to carry in a laptop bag while providing enough juice for a full laptop charge and a phone.

Q: Can a USB-C power bank charge a laptop and a phone at the same time?

A: Yes, dual-port models with PD output can simultaneously deliver up to 65 W, sufficient to charge a laptop while also powering a smartphone, provided the total draw does not exceed the bank’s rated output.

Q: How long does it take to fully recharge a high-capacity power bank?

A: Using a 45-W or higher wall charger, most 20,000-30,000 mAh units reach a full charge in three to four hours; models with built-in GaN technology can be slightly faster.
